3 votes

tableau référencé == tableau

Pourriez-vous me dire pourquoi la valeur d'un référencé et la valeur du tableau lui-même ont la même valeur ?

Je sais que a est un type d'int* mais avec &a, ce devrait être int** ou est-ce que je me trompe ? donc la valeur devrait être un pointeur vers le pointeur int. exemple de code :

    #include <stdio.h>

    int main()
    {
        int a\[10\];
        printf("a without ref.: 0x%x\\n",a);
        printf("a with    ref.: 0x%x\\n",&a);
        return 0;
    }

http://ideone.com/KClQJ

Prograide.com

Prograide est une communauté de développeurs qui cherche à élargir la connaissance de la programmation au-delà de l'anglais.
Pour cela nous avons les plus grands doutes résolus en français et vous pouvez aussi poser vos propres questions ou résoudre celles des autres.

Powered by:

X